      Very rarely, Minecraft will start and have all its sounds working perfectly, but most of the time Minecraft will have no sound at all and be super creepy. I still haven't figured out the magic recipe for having sounds.

      OpenAL seems properly initialized; it says so in the launcher log that I can't copy-paste because of another bug. So this is not a duplicate of MCL-169.

      This happens in 1.6.1 and 1.6.2. I now have the new new launcher, let's call it "the second widget-full launcher". The problem also occurred with the old new launcher, the "first widget-full one".

      EDIT:
      I uninstalled Pulseaudio, falling back on ALSA only. Now the sound works. This does not solve the issue since every Ubuntu and Mint distribs of the past few years have Pulseaudio installed by default.
